wikipedia_growth: en-Wikipedia links (2007).

The network of hyperlinks among English wikipedia pages, in 2007.

1870709 nodes, 39953145 edges.

google: Google internal webpages (2007).

A directed network of webpages from Google's own sites, and the hyperlinks among them.

15763 nodes, 171206 edges.
